Bank of New York Mellon Corp raised its position in shares of Acadia Realty Trust (NYSE:AKR - Free Report) by 5.4%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The firm owned 1,110,758 shares of the real estate investment trust's stock after purchasing an additional 56,614 shares during the quarter. Bank of New York Mellon Corp owned approximately 0.93% of Acadia Realty Trust worth $26,836,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Acadia Realty Trust Increases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, April 15th. Investors of record on Monday, March 31st will be given a dividend of $0.20 per share. This is a boost from Acadia Realty Trust's previous quarterly dividend of $0.19. The ex-dividend date is Monday, March 31st. This represents a $0.80 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.71%. Acadia Realty Trust's payout ratio is presently 444.44%.

Acadia Realty Trust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Acadia Realty Trust is an equity real estate investment trust focused on delivering long-term, profitable growth via its dual Core Portfolio and Fund operating platforms and its disciplined, location-driven investment strategy. Acadia Realty Trust is accomplishing this goal by building a best-in-class core real estate portfolio with meaningful concentrations of assets in the nation's most dynamic corridors; making profitable opportunistic and value-add investments through its series of discretionary, institutional funds; and maintaining a strong balance sheet.
